For the purposes of this Act, the following are objects of industrial property rights: (1) inventions registered pursuant to the Patents Act, the Utility Models Act or the Implementation of Convention on Grant of European Patents Act (RT I 2002, 38, 233); (2) layout-designs of integrated circuits registered pursuant to the Layout-Designs of Integrated Circuits Protection Act; (3) trade marks and service marks registered pursuant to the Trade Marks Act; and (4) industrial designs registered pursuant to the Industrial Design Protection Act.
